Belt drive problems, which include shaft misalignment, pulley misalignment, belt wear, belt resonance, belts too tight, belts too loose, pulley eccentricity and bent shafts, can be relatively straight forward to detect but can be far more difficult to specifically diagnose and correct. Belt drive, in machinery, a pair of pulleys attached to usually parallel shafts and connected by an encircling flexible belt band that can serve to transmit and modify rotary motion from one shaft to the other.

In order for a belt drive to operate properly, the residual tension in the loose span the nondriving span of the belt can never be allowed to get near zero unlike a chain drive, where the loose span can actually be loose.
